Cairo: Gaza's reconstruction plan, prepared by Egypt and approved by the recent emergency Arab summit in Cairo, will witness increased coordination with various regional and international parties, said Egyptian Prime Minister Dr. Mostafa Madbouly Sunday.
According to Kuwait News Agency, the Egyptian cabinet noted that this announcement came during a meeting held by Madbouly and Palestinian Prime Minister and Minister of Foreign Affairs Dr. Mohamad Mustafa. The Egyptian prime minister reiterated Egypt's unwavering support for the Palestinians and efforts to rebuild the Gaza Strip, while ensuring that Palestinian citizens remain on their land.
The statement highlighted the agreement between the two sides to continue consultations and coordination during the coming period. This collaboration aims to support efforts for implementing the reconstruction plan and maintaining the ceasefire.
